Chocolate pneumatic conveying systems are specialized equipment used in the food processing industry, particularly for the efficient and hygienic transport of chocolate and related ingredients. These systems utilize air pressure to move bulk materials through a pipeline network, ensuring a clean and controlled environment that meets stringent food safety standards. As a key component in chocolate production lines, such systems play a crucial role in maintaining product quality and operational efficiency.

The design of a chocolate pneumatic conveying system is built on several fundamental principles that ensure optimal performance and reliability. The primary mechanism involves creating a pressure differential between the inlet and outlet of the system. By injecting air into the conveying line, the system generates a flow that propels the chocolate particles forward. This process, known as pneumatic conveying, eliminates the need for mechanical components like belts or buckets, reducing maintenance requirements and minimizing the risk of contamination.
A critical aspect of the design is the selection of appropriate air velocities and pressure levels. Too low a velocity may cause material settling or blockages, while excessive velocity can lead to wear on the system components and energy inefficiency. Engineers typically calculate the required air velocity based on the density and particle size of the chocolate being conveyed, ensuring that the system operates within safe and efficient parameters. Additionally, the system incorporates features like cyclone separators and filters to separate the chocolate from the air, preventing dust and debris from contaminating the product and the environment.

Chocolate pneumatic conveying systems consist of several key components that work in tandem to achieve effective material transport. The main elements include a feed hopper, which holds the chocolate or ingredients and feeds them into the conveying line; a blower or compressor that generates the necessary air pressure; a conveying pipe network that transports the material; and a receiver or discharge hopper where the material is collected. Some systems may also include additional components like rotary valves, which control the flow of material into the system, and cyclone separators, which separate the material from the air stream.

Implementing a chocolate pneumatic conveying system offers several advantages over traditional mechanical conveying methods. First, it provides a hygienic and dust-free environment, which is essential for maintaining the quality and safety of chocolate products. The enclosed system prevents contamination from external sources and reduces the risk of product degradation due to exposure to air or moisture. Second, pneumatic conveying systems are highly flexible, allowing for changes in production volume and layout without significant modifications. This adaptability makes them suitable for both small-scale and large-scale chocolate production facilities. Third, the system reduces labor costs by automating the material handling process, minimizing the need for manual labor in transporting heavy or bulky materials. Finally, the energy efficiency of pneumatic conveying systems, particularly when using low-pressure or vacuum systems, contributes to lower operational costs over time.

Proper maintenance is crucial to ensure the longevity and efficiency of a chocolate pneumatic conveying system. Regular cleaning of the conveying lines, filters, and cyclone separators is necessary to prevent clogging and maintain air flow. Additionally, checking the blower or compressor for proper operation and replacing worn parts, such as seals and bearings, helps to avoid system failures. Operational considerations also include monitoring air pressure and flow rates to ensure the system is running at optimal levels. By adhering to a regular maintenance schedule and following operational guidelines, manufacturers can maximize the performance and lifespan of their chocolate pneumatic conveying systems.
